This collection was not what I expected and at same time, exceeded what I expected based on the color I applied. Sound confusing? Let me explain. I was expecting polishes to lean towards the foil finish with a more metallic look to it. I mean, look at the bottle pics, what would you expect?
I started off with Chrome Green and it was… okay. The color was a super mild green. But instead of applying like a foil (which is probably one of the easiest finishes to apply), it applied more like a pearl. There were slight brush strokes so application had to be careful. It’s not a bad polish, but it didn’t blow my socks off.

Navy Blue, however, far exceeded what I was expecting. Saturated color, no brushstrokes, great depth. It almost reminded me of the OPI Suedes with topcoat. All are shown with 2 coats.
When I moved on to Chrome Pewter, it was more like Chrome Green. Fortunately Chrome Purple resembled the application of Chrome Navy. There is obviously two different formulas at work here – two of which I loved and two which I was simply “meh” about. If I were to do it over again, I’d forgo the Green and Pewter. The Navy and the Purple are must haves!
